woodland; NA% other; about 50% cultivated Environment: large, deepwater harbor at St. Peter Port Note: 52 km west of France - People Population: 57,227 (July 1990), growth rate 0.7% (1990) Birth rate: 12 births/1,000 population (1990) Death rate: 11 deaths/1,000 population (1990) Net migration rate: 6 migrants/1,000 population (1990) Infant mortality rate: 6 deaths/1,000 live births (1990) Life expectancy at birth: 72 years male, 78 years female (1990) Total fertility rate: 1.6 children born/woman (1990) Nationality: noun--Channel Islander(s); adjective--Channel Islander Ethnic divisions: UK and Norman-French descent Religion: Anglican, Roman Catholic, Presbyterian, Baptist, Congregational, Methodist Language: English, French; Norman-French dialect spoken in country districts Literacy: NA%, but universal education Labor force: NA Organized labor: NA - Government Long-form name: Bailiwick of Guernsey Type: British crown dependency Capital: St. Peter Port Administrative divisions: none (British crown dependency) Independence: none (British crown dependency) Constitution: unwritten; partly statutes, partly common law and practice Legal system: English law and local statute; justice is administered by the Royal Court National holiday: Liberation Day, 9 May (1945) Executive branch: British monarch, lieutenant governor, bailiff, deputy bailiff Legislative branch: States of Deliberation Judicial branch: Royal Court Leaders: Chief of State--Queen ELIZABETH II (since 6 February 1952); Head of Government--Lieutenant Governor Lt. Gen. Sir Alexander BOSWELL (since 1985); Bailiff Sir Charles FROSSARD (since 1982) Political parties and leaders: none; all independents Suffrage: universal at age 18 Elections: States of Deliberation--last held NA (next to be held NA); results--percent of vote NA; seats--(60 total, 33 elected), all independents Communists: none Diplomatic representation: none (British crown dependency) Flag: white with the red cross of St. George (patron saint of England) extending to the edges of the flag - Economy Overview: Tourism is a major source of revenue. Other economic activity includes financial services, breeding the world-famous Guernsey cattle, and growing tomatoes and flowers for export.
